Basel-Stadt Mortality in August 2026 by Sex and Age Group

September 16, 2026

In August 2026, Basel-Stadt recorded 157 deaths and an overall mortality rate of 74.6 per 100,000, which was a 40 percent increase over the exceptionally low August 2025 but still below the long-term August average. The rise was broad-based across sexes and age groups, with women aged 65 and older remaining the most affected group in absolute terms.

In August 2026, the canton of Basel-Stadt recorded 157 deaths, comprising 69 men and 88 women. The total population used for rate calculation was approximately 210,456, yielding an overall mortality rate of 74.6 deaths per 100,000 inhabitants. Among men, the mortality rate was 67.2 per 100,000, while among women it was 81.6 per 100,000. The age group most affected was those aged 65 and older, with 58 male deaths and 83 female deaths in that category. The mortality rate for men aged 65 and older was 334.5 per 100,000, and for women aged 65 and older it was 360.9 per 100,000. Women aged 65 and older thus had both the highest absolute number of deaths and the highest age-specific mortality rate.

Looking at the same month in the previous year, August 2025, the canton recorded 112 deaths, with 48 men and 64 women. The total mortality rate was 54.0 per 100,000, with men at 47.5 and women at 60.1. Among those aged 65 and older, there were 45 male deaths and 58 female deaths, corresponding to mortality rates of 264.9 and 254.7 per 100,000 respectively. August 2025 was the lowest month on record since 2005 for total deaths, male deaths, female deaths, and all major mortality rates.

Comparing August 2026 with August 2025, total deaths increased by 45, from 112 to 157, a rise of 40 percent. Male deaths increased from 48 to 69, and female deaths from 64 to 88. The total mortality rate rose from 54.0 to 74.6 per 100,000, an increase of 20.6 percentage points. The male mortality rate increased from 47.5 to 67.2, and the female rate from 60.1 to 81.6. The most pronounced relative increase occurred among men under 65, whose mortality rate more than tripled from 3.6 to 12.9 per 100,000, although the absolute number of deaths in this group remained low at 11. Among those aged 65 and older, male mortality rose from 264.9 to 334.5 per 100,000, and female mortality from 254.7 to 360.9 per 100,000.

Compared with the historical average for August since 2005, August 2026 was below average. The average total deaths for August was 169.6, compared with 157 in 2026. Average male deaths was 74.3, compared with 69, and average female deaths was 95.4, compared with 88. The average total mortality rate was 86.5 per 100,000, compared with 74.6 in 2026. The average male mortality rate was 78.7, compared with 67.2, and the average female rate was 93.7, compared with 81.6. For men under 65, the average mortality rate was 17.4, compared with 12.9 in 2026, and for women under 65 the average was 10.4, compared with 5.9. For men aged 65 and older, the average rate was 386.9, compared with 334.5, and for women aged 65 and older the average was 375.8, compared with 360.9.

The data show that August 2026 was a relatively moderate month for mortality in Basel-Stadt. It was substantially higher than the exceptionally low August 2025, but still below the long-term average for August. The increase from 2025 was broad-based across both sexes and all age groups, with the largest relative rise among men under 65, though this group contributes few absolute deaths. Women aged 65 and older remained the most affected group in absolute terms, with 83 deaths and a mortality rate of 360.9 per 100,000, which was above the 2025 level but below the historical average for that group. No unusual patterns or deviations beyond the rebound from the 2025 low are evident in the data.
